Can ZoneRead tell me whether to sign?
No — and that limit is deliberate, not a shortcoming. ZoneRead reads the contract, explains it in plain English, and flags what's in it. Whether to sign is a decision for you, with a licensed attorney where the stakes call for one. Anything that told you what to do would be legal advice, which ZoneRead is not licensed to give.
Is ZoneRead a law firm?
No. ZoneRead is not a law firm, doesn't provide legal advice, and using it doesn't create an attorney–client relationship. If you decide you want a lawyer, you can request a referral to an independent attorney who works for you — ZoneRead never routes a deal to an attorney on its own.
Does ZoneRead cover the cost of an attorney?
No. If you request a referral and engage an attorney, anything that attorney charges is set by them, billed by them, and paid directly to them — it is not included in your ZoneRead subscription or any other ZoneRead price. Their rates and terms are theirs to set and explain. ZoneRead's role ends at the introduction: we are not part of your engagement with that attorney, we receive no payment from them, and we do not share in their fees.
Who pays ZoneRead?
You do — and only you. ZoneRead is never paid by a school, brand, agent, or collective. That's the whole point: the moment the other side of your deal is paying us, our read isn't worth anything to you.

The athlete is under 18. Can we use this?
Yes — a parent or legal guardian creates and controls the account and accepts the Terms on the athlete's behalf. High-school NIL rules vary sharply by state, and some states restrict it heavily, so confirm specifics with your state association.
If a deal is moving fast
Pressure to sign quickly is itself worth noticing — a deal that can't survive a day of review is telling you something. Read the free About NIL pages, run a free preview, and talk to a parent or guardian before anything gets signed.
